Philippe Starck, the French product designer was born in Paris in 1949. With regards Furniture, he is famous for his designs that are made from polycarbonate plastic. World famous products he has designed include the transparent Louis Ghost chair, Eros chair, Bubble Club sofa, and La Bohème stool. He has also been involved in the re-launch of the World War II-era Navy Chair in the U.S., designing a classic furniture collection around it. Unlike most other New Design artists, Starck’s work does not concentrate on creating provocative and expensive single pieces. Instead, his product designs are of usable household items which Starck himself helps to market for mass production.
